This last scene is one of the most beautiful scenes on this show in a good, long while. Kara gets a knock on her loft door, and when she opens it, everything goes totally still. No score underneath, no sounds, nothing. Just stillness and silence as the camera slowly pans to reveal Lena Luthor at her door.

Without saying a word, Kara steps back from the open door. A silent invitation. A gesture that shows that though she might not have the words to invite Lena in, she might have the room to let her in.

lena enters kara's loft
“I will not let anything, take away what’s standing in front of me. Every breath, every hour has come to this. One step closer.”

Lena takes a wavering breath and says, “I have made a terrible mistake.” Lena sets aside the Luthor pride that was drilled into her from years of being raised with and by sociopaths, she moves through the grudge she was clinging to like a life raft, she musters up all of her strength, and she apologizes to Kara. She says she was genuinely trying to do something good, she wanted to take away people’s pain. She was tired, so tired, from being hurt over and over and over again, so she thought this was the only way forward. Tears start to fall from her eyes as she tells Kara she was right, she was acting like a villain. Kara looks uncomfortable at the reminder.

Lena says that she went down a dark path and couldn’t see that she was setting the forest on fire to try to save the trees from being chopped down. She knows it’s too much to ask Kara to forgive her, so she won’t even try. All she wants is for Kara to listen. She tells Kara that Lex is working with Leviathan, and manipulating her tech to do something terrible via Obsidian. She didn’t realize until it was too late that she was unwittingly helping the enemy. She wants to help stop them. She wants to help KARA. Please.

Kara takes a deep breath and considers this woman who stands before her. The person who has hurt her more than she’s been hurt before, because of how deeply she cared. The person she’s hurt deeper than she’s hurt anyone before, for the same reason. The woman whose mother and brother are evil geniuses but who has stood by her side time and time again. The woman who didn’t know she was Supergirl, but saved her life anyway. Before this moment, Kara was afraid to reach out for hope that might not be there. That they were too far gone now, too many bridges burned to find their way back to each other. And honestly I worried the same. But now, watching Lena be more vulnerable than she’s ever been, doing two of the hardest things anyone can do – admitting that she was wrong and asking for help – Kara makes her choice. She reaches out. And she pulls out a chair, offering Lena a seat at her table.
